Understanding Your Medications: Prescription vs. OTC
Navigating the realm of pharmaceuticals can be confusing , especially when telling the difference between prescription and over-the-counter selections. Rx medications require a physician's approval and are typically used to treat more significant illnesses. Conversely, over-the-counter remedies are available without one and are intended for everyday aches . It's vital to consistently read the instructions on any drug and discuss your physician about potential effects before consuming them.

Active Medicinal Ingredients: Which They Are and What These Matter
Active Drug Ingredients, often abbreviated as APIs, constitute the portion of a drug that creates the desired effect. Essentially, they comprise the biologically efficacious molecule responsible for addressing a disease. These importance resides in the fact that the API's purity directly affect the efficacy and success of the final treatment. Consequently, careful assessment of API creation and procurement is absolutely vital to consumer health and safety.
Understanding Drug Assistance
Navigating the tricky landscape of prescription plans can feel challenging, especially with such options available. It's key is to grasp how your benefit works. Often, this involves a formulary – your list of medications that are covered . Various tiers on the formulary establish the expense . Higher tiers generally mean more individual costs. check here Think about using digital resources provided by your medical organization to check drug costs and potential alternatives. In addition , avoid refrain to contact a medication specialist or insurance representative for guidance.

Personalized Pharmacies : Specialized Services for Distinct Requirements
Traditional drugstores often don't fulfill the exact requirements of every patient. Personalized medicine drugstores step in to address this difference, delivering custom-made medications. These experienced pharmacists accurately formulate ingredients to produce dosage forms – like creams , liquids , or pills – that are ideally suited to a patient’s unique circumstance. This permits for adjustments in concentration, type, and consistency, assisting patients with sensitivities , challenges swallowing, or those requiring medications not readily accessible through conventional manufacturing.
